编程需要什么样的显卡
-
编程过程中对显卡的要求相对较低,主要是为了保证开发环境的流畅运行和辅助调试。以下是编程所需显卡的一些特点和要求:
-
显示性能:编程过程中通常不需要高性能的显卡。基本的2D显示即可满足需求,无需购买高端显卡。
-
多显示器支持:对于大多数程序员来说,多显示器是非常有用的工具。因此,显卡需要支持多个显示器的连接,以提高工作效率。
-
显存容量:显存容量对于编程来说并不是特别重要。通常,4GB到8GB的显存已经足够满足编程需求。
-
显卡驱动支持:选择显卡时,需要确保其对应的驱动程序能够兼容你所使用的操作系统和开发环境。
-
接口类型:根据你的电脑主板的接口类型,选择支持相应接口的显卡。目前,常见的接口类型有PCI Express和AGP。
总结来说,编程所需的显卡不需要过高的性能,主要需要支持多显示器连接和兼容你的操作系统和开发环境。因此,选择一款适合自己需求的中低端显卡即可满足编程的需求。
1年前 -
-
编程并不需要特别高级的显卡,因为大部分编程任务并不需要大量的图形处理能力。然而,对于一些特定的编程任务和开发环境,一些显卡特性可能会提供额外的优势。以下是一些需要考虑的显卡特性:
-
显示输出:显卡需要至少一个视频输出端口,如HDMI、DisplayPort或VGA,以便将计算机的图形输出连接到显示器。
-
多显示器支持:如果你需要同时连接多个显示器进行开发工作,那么你需要一个支持多显示器的显卡。大部分现代显卡都支持双显示器输出,一些高级显卡甚至可以支持更多显示器。
-
显存容量:显存是显卡用来存储和处理图像数据的内存。对于大规模图像处理或者需要处理大型数据集的编程任务,较大的显存容量可能会提供更好的性能。
-
GPU计算能力:一些编程任务,如机器学习、深度学习和科学计算,可以受益于显卡的GPU计算能力。一些显卡具有专门用于加速这些任务的GPU计算单元,如NVIDIA的CUDA或AMD的ROCm。
-
驱动支持:选择一款有良好驱动支持的显卡非常重要,特别是当你使用的是特定的操作系统或开发工具时。一些显卡制造商提供定期更新的驱动程序,以确保其显卡在各种操作系统和开发环境下的兼容性和性能。
需要注意的是,对于大多数编程任务而言,显卡并不是性能瓶颈。更重要的因素是CPU、内存和存储器的性能。因此,在购买显卡时,应该根据自己的具体需求和预算来选择适合的显卡。
1年前 -
-
编程并不需要特别高端的显卡,但是一些特定的编程任务可能对显卡性能有一定的要求。下面是一些常见的编程任务和对显卡性能的要求:
-
基本编程任务:对于一般的编程任务,如编写代码、调试程序、编译代码等,一般的集成显卡就可以满足需求。这些任务对显卡性能要求不高,因为它们主要依赖于 CPU 的计算能力。
-
3D 图形编程:如果你从事与图形相关的编程任务,如游戏开发或计算机图形学研究,你可能需要一块较高性能的显卡。这是因为这些任务需要在屏幕上绘制复杂的图像,并进行实时的渲染和计算。对于这些任务,你可能需要考虑购买一块专业的图形处理器(GPU),如NVIDIA 的 Quadro 系列或AMD 的 FirePro 系列。
-
机器学习和数据科学:如果你从事机器学习、深度学习或数据科学等任务,你可能需要一块强大的显卡来加速计算过程。这是因为这些任务通常涉及到大规模的矩阵运算和并行计算,而显卡的并行计算能力比 CPU 更强大。在这种情况下,你可能需要购买一块支持 CUDA 或 OpenCL 的显卡,如NVIDIA 的 GeForce GTX 系列或AMD 的 Radeon 系列。
-
虚拟化和云计算:如果你在虚拟化或云计算领域工作,你可能需要一块高性能的显卡来支持虚拟机的图形加速和 GPU 计算。这些任务通常需要支持 GPU 虚拟化技术的显卡,如NVIDIA 的 Tesla 系列或AMD 的 Radeon Pro 系列。
总的来说,一般的编程任务并不需要特别高端的显卡,但如果你从事与图形、机器学习、虚拟化等领域相关的编程任务,你可能需要考虑购买一块较高性能的显卡来提高工作效率。
1年前 -